Erin Ranney 'I just completely fell in love with cameras'
In this episode we go for a Bristol wander with camerawoman Erin Ranney. We chat about growing up in bear country, her route into natural history filmmaking and separating work from worth.

Ellie Williams '‘Sounds really connect us to a place and make us feel a certain way.’
In this episode we go for a dawn chorus wander with sound recordist Ellie Williams. In a forest near Bristol, we chat about capturing soundscapes, pushing boundaries and exploring sensory bubbles.

Jack Bootle ‘I think it’s the best job in TV, truly’
In this episode of the Plodcast we go for a wander with the Head of Specialist Factual Commissioning at the BBC, Jack Bootle. In the heart of London we chat about being a TV addict, his career path to commissioning and predicting the future.

Charlie Hamilton-James ‘I want you to look at a picture that’s so disturbing that you can’t help thinking, holy s**t, that’s so beautiful.’
In the first episode of Season 4 we go for a walk in the Wiltshire countryside with wildlife filmmaker and photographer Charlie Hamilton-James. We chat about filming two of the UK’s most loved species, his emotional journey behind this camera and scrolling to indifference.

Jamie McPherson ‘What I find most exciting is just different ways of telling stories’
In this final episode of season 3 we go for a West Country wander with wildlife cinematographer Jamie McPherson. We chat about starting in TV, immersive gimbal filming and seeing dinosaurs everywhere.

Natural Wanders is a 'Plodcast' that gets you outside to connect with people and nature. In each episode, Mandi Stark is joined for a chat by a guest wanderer from the worlds of TV, film, wildlife or conservation as they take an exploratory plod around a wild place they love.
